Mandarin Orange Fluff Recipe

Mandarin Orange Fluff is a light, creamy, and fruity dessert salad made with orange jello, instant vanilla pudding, cool whip, mini marshmallows, and well-drained mandarin oranges and crushed pineapple. This easy no-cook recipe comes together quickly and is chilled to perfection, making it a refreshing and sweet treat perfect for potlucks, family gatherings, and holiday celebrations.

Ingredients

Scale

Gelatin and Pudding Base

  • 3 oz box orange jello mix
  • 1 cup (236ml) boiling water
  • 1/2 cup (118ml) cold water
  • 3.4 oz box instant vanilla pudding

Mix-ins

  • 8 oz cool whip
  • 2 cups (86g) mini marshmallows
  • two 15 oz cans mandarin oranges (drained very well)
  • 20 oz can crushed pineapple (drained very well)

Instructions

  1. Dissolve the Jello Mix: In a large mixing bowl, combine the orange jello mix with 1 cup of boiling water. Whisk thoroughly until the jello is completely dissolved. Then, add 1/2 cup cold water and whisk again to combine. Place the bowl in the refrigerator for 15 minutes to let the gelatin mixture begin to set.
  2. Add the Pudding Mix: Remove the bowl from the refrigerator and whisk in the instant vanilla pudding mix, making sure to scrape the sides of the bowl to fully incorporate the pudding powder. Return the bowl to the fridge for another 15 minutes to let the pudding thicken.
  3. Fold in the Cool Whip: Take the bowl out of the fridge and gently fold in the cool whip until the mixture is smooth and evenly combined.
  4. Incorporate Fruits and Marshmallows: Add the mini marshmallows along with the well-drained mandarin oranges and crushed pineapple. Carefully fold these ingredients into the mixture to keep the fluff light and airy.
  5. Chill Before Serving: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 2 hours. This chilling step allows the fluff to set and the marshmallows to soften, resulting in a creamy, luscious texture ready to serve.

Notes

  • Ensure the canned mandarin oranges and crushed pineapple are drained very well to avoid watery fluff.
  • For an extra festive touch, garnish with a few whole mandarin orange segments or a sprinkle of mini marshmallows on top before serving.
  • This recipe can be easily doubled or halved depending on serving needs.
  • Leftovers can be stored covered in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
